As the foundation of growth, being able to with assurance decide is among the most essential business leadership skills for fulfilling objectives. In the business context, leaders are often challenged with multifaceted choices that necessitate thoughtful analysis and sound judgment in their navigation. Decisive decision-making involves assessing options, effectively judging risk and selecting the optimal course of action for the organisation's advancement. Along with this, competent leaders accept responsibility for their decisions. Values such as responsibility are significant in leadership credibility, whereby individuals with decision-making powers ought to own both their successes and failures and gain insight from their errors. This sets a good example for others while nurturing an environment of honesty within an organisation. As the core of effective business leadership, having a clear vision is one of the most influential elements of long-term progress and security. Vision usually offers a sense of direction by defining both the short and sustained objectives, offering team members an aim to progress towards. A leader who can successfully articulate a vision will comprehend not only where the organisation currently stands, but also its future direction. This can be enhanced by skills such as logical reasoning, which helps to convert a vision into a practical plan. In the modern global economic landscape, it is more essential for businesses to adapt to international markets and cross-cultural stakeholder networks. In order to achieve this, one of the most crucial components of any business leadership model is clear communication. As the face and representative for an organization, a leader must express their ideas clearly to a variety of audiences, both internal and external to the organization. Effective communication as a leader includes an understanding of the different stakeholder audiences and their engagement with the business, in order to tailor messages to be understood as intended. This can involve engaging employees with regard and understanding, alongside working with investors.
